Pindra
Pindra is a village located in Dadi subdivision of Hazaribagh district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 52km away from district headquarter Dadi. Dadi is the sub-district headquarter of Pindra village. As per 2009 stats, Rabodh is the gram panchayat of Pindra village.

About Pindra
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Pindra is 368933. The village spans a total geographical area of 147 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 825330. Ramgarh is nearest town to Pindra village for all major economic activities.
When it comes to local governance, Pindra village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Mandhu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Hazaribagh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Pindra
Below is a concise population overview of Pindra as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 34 | 21 | 13 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 4 | 4 | N/A |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 24 | 16 | 8 |
Illiterate Population | 10 | 5 | 5 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Pindra village:
- The total population of Pindra village is around 34, including approximately 21 males and 13 females, with a sex ratio of 619 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 4 children aged 0–6 years in Pindra village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- The literacy rate of Pindra village is about 70.59%, with male literacy at 76.19% and female literacy at 61.54%.
- There are around 6 households in Pindra village.
Connectivity of Pindra
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Pindra. As per the 2011 stats, Pindra had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
